RFID tags represent a innovative method for identifying items. These tiny devices leverage radio waves to relay data remotely to a scanner . Unlike standard barcodes, RFID setups don't demand a visible line of contact, allowing for faster data retrieval and improved stock oversight. They function by holding a microchip and an radiating element that facilitates this exchange.

Understanding RFID Tag Frequency Options (LF, HF, UHF)
Picking the appropriate RFID transponder frequency is critical for successful system. Limited Frequency (LF) solutions, operating at around 125-134 kHz, offer limited read ranges, typically under 1 meter, and are well-suited for demanding environments. Higher Frequency (HF), typically utilizing 13.56 MHz, provides increased read distances, extending from a few centimeters to numerous meters, and enables advanced data transmission rates. Ultra High Frequency, covering 860-960 MHz, presents the greatest read range, possibly exceeding 10 meters, yet is highly to obstructions and demands a unobstructed line of visibility.

Comparing RFID Tag Materials: Durability & Cost
Selecting right RFID label materials involves detailed consideration of multiple durability plus cost. Standard options, like paper, plastic (often PET or PVC), and metalized films, present unique trade-offs. Paper devices are generally the least expensive but provide minimal material protection, making them unsuitable for demanding environments. Plastic tags, particularly PET, boast better durability, resisting damage and wetness, but involve a higher price. Metalized sheets are employed for particular applications needing shielding from radio interference, leading in the greatest cost.
